We’ve got over a hundred submissions from our recent poll on mobile 3G services. The results are not that surprising but the breakdown of services is a bit interesting though. See figures and graphs after the jump.

Quite a number of users have already been using their new uMobile SIMs too (7.19%) while fledgling Sun Cellular 3G is still down there. Surprisingly, very few people are using PLDT WeRoam — a service which has practically been supplanted by SmartBro Mobile 3G.

3G usage is split between Smart/PLDT and Globe Telecom two-to-one as shown in the table below.

Sun Cellular may get additional share by end of this year once they market their 3G services. uMobile on the other hand, though an autonomous telco is still considered a Smart/PLDT property and their free ad-supported 3G services will certainly bump up their total numbers.
